One of United's specialties is Omega. Alan, the main technician attended an Omega Technical Seminar and received the Swatch Group US, Certificate of Completion of Omega's Service Provider Training. Certificates are proudly displayed in their shop. I bought a second hand Globemaster Two Tone Sedna and brought it to Jessy and Alan to give it a fresh "new to me" start. It is always good to bring the watch in (or send it Registered Mail) for a qualified assessment. Ballpark phone estimates are not useful because you will never know what can of worms you have opened. Jessy and Alan are very honest and transparent as to what they can or cannot do - best case scenario and worst case scenario. Jessy brought the watch to Alan where he was working. My timepiece was running very slow. Best case was disassembly, cleaning, assembly, lubrication, and calibration. Worst case was a bad escapement which would cost a lot more. I also wanted a very small ding buffed out; which you can't see except close up at a certain angle. Jessy explained to me that the watch had been buffed one other time by someone else. Buffing this miniscule ding would compromise the integrity of the case so I said no. I am more than delighted at the calibration. My Globemaster is now running at +1 - far exceeding Metas as far as timing. I have another Omega which was also running slow but was sent to the service center under warranty; the best they could do was +4. Sending your Omega to the Omega Service Center will take months. Jessy and Alan did mine in less than a week. They are 50 miles away from me but it is definitely worth the drive and navigating through SF to have the work done.

I will sum this review quickly for those who are doing their research on service centers, and do not care to read the rest: Alan is an incredibly talented watchmaker, and my Rolex came out looking brand new and running perfectly. I am so glad I found United Watch after the RSC in SF closed their doors. The price was fair and expected of a master watchmaker with all Swiss equipment and training. Do not take your multi-thousand dollar Swiss watch to a jeweler, they will butcher the movement and damage the watch. Take it to Alan at United Watch Services. The rest of the story: I have been collecting watches for a long time (mostly Swiss) and I have always bit the bullet and sent them back to the factory and waited multiple months for them to return. When my reliable Rolex Submariner stopped auto winding (would randomly stop running while wearing) I knew it was time for a service. I did a lot of research and ended up settling on United Watch Services due to their Swiss credentials and stellar reviews. I was greeted by Alan's brother Jessy who is a pleasure to talk to. While he inspected the watch he took the time to share their family history and involvement with Rolex specifically. Jessy made sure to tell me that Alan would inspect the watch, give me a quote, and there would be no hard feelings if I decided to not move forward with the service. Within a day Jessy texted me the quote and took the time to call me and walk through everything that was needed on the watch. The price was very fair (most Rolex Service Centers charge about 1k just for general service and cleaning) so I went ahead with the service. Here is the real benefit of a local watchmaker, within 4 days the watch was back on my wrist looking and running perfectly - I did not have to wait 2+ months (plus shipping risk)! Alan also took the time to share some photos of the service which was an unexpected treat! As a watch enthusiast, seeing each piece of the watch taken apart, the multi level pressure testing, the cleaning machines, was all incredibly fascinating! Also, my watch came out looking better than when I sent it in! It looks like when it first came out of the box. I liked the service so much that I just sent brought them another piece that has water damange for Alan to work on. Thank you again Alan and Jessy!
